Visual trap between payant and posant
These two trip readers on the page rather than in the ear: payant is \pɛ.jɑ̃\ while posant is \po.zɑ̃\. Spoken aloud the problem disappears. In writing it persists, because they share most of their letters but differ in 2 positions, and the parts of speech differ too (adjective vs verb), which is usually the fastest check.
